Quest List
While traveling to different places, you will come across an NPC, asking for your help. They will give you a quest to do certain task for them. And once you complete the quest, they will give you the reward. Most of the quests give you either one Blue Coffee or Starseed while very few give out both Blue Coffee and Starseed or more. Here’s a list of quests while you’re traveling.
If you’re unsure what your quests are, click the Quest button that has a picture of a cat and you will see your quests.
Quest Title Activate the Quest - ((Description of the Quest))
Sunshire
Find Nova Tutorial – You need to find Nova (first NPC you’ve met). Go to East Summer Road.
Capture Beefee East Summer Road - Nova asks you to capture a Moga named Beefee to be added into your team. Go to West Summer Road and capture Beefee.
Help Out West Summer Road - Nova informs you that there’s someone (Lyle) who needs your help. Go to Summer Field.
Get Gertrude’s Chocolates Summer Field – Lyle’s chocolates for his girlfriend got stolen and needs you to get it back (He’s too afraid to get stung again.) Go to Warmwood Trail and hunt down Wasabee.
Defeat Owlreed Warmwood Trail – Nova needs your assistance to get rid of Owlreed who is guarding the forest. Go to Shadowmire Edge and defeat Owlreed (Need to be level 3 or higher to fight.)
Find the Soldier Shadowmire Edge – Nova informs you that she’s sending you to someone (Pierce) who can use your assistance. Go to Darkwood Vault.
Care Package Miasma Depths – Lyle needs your help to deliver a package to his girlfriend. Travel to Windhym and go to Gertrude’s House. (You don’t need to go immediately. Just take your time before reaching there.)
Kill 5 Trolos Darkwood Vault - Pierce orders you to kill 5 Trolos to prove your strength. Show him how tough you are. Kill 5 Trolos between Miasma Depths and Darkwood Vault.
Find the Shady Tamer Completing Killing 5 Trolos – Pierce asks you to check up on a person (Skylar) since he doesn’t trust the person. Head to Trollworthy Bridge.
Light Shellstone Lighthouse Shellstone Lighthouse – The lighthouse keeper needs your help to bring the Starlight or else boats will be crushed. Hunt down the Twister between Sandswirl Shrubwalk and Sandswirl Tidal Pool until they drop Starlight.
Purple Pincers Swirly Pier – A tribal woman wants you to bring Purple Pincers for her ingredients. Collect 15* Purple Pincers from Crabaos between Light Shellstone Lighthouse and Sandswirl Beach. ((*Warning: Number of collecting Purple Pincers may change vary.*))
Defeat Sheepguy Spiral Path – Sheepguy won’t let you walk pass him. Defeat his Moga, Munyu.
Incriminating Photos Completing Defeat Sheepguy – Sheepguy needs your assistance to bring back “incriminating” pictures that may ruin his reputation. Defeat Woolf at Spiral Cave. * Update: Woolf can be fought at Daydusk for the photos.
Poetry in Motion Heavenly Green Cemetery – Poe needs your help to deliver his poetry to his beloved Lenore, but is unable to go because of a Moga terrifying him. Defeat Winja at Thornwood (However, if you want a Winja, this is your chance to capture it. Need to be level 13 or higher to enter.)
Windhym Welcome Gates of Wyndhym – A soldier informs you to go listen to the Mayor’s speech if you want to figure out what causes the earthquake. Go to Wyndhym Town Square.
Find CORTEX Wyndhym Town Square – The Mayor believes that the problem is caused in Cortex and wants you to find it. Cortex can be found in Cortex Shell at Pueblonia Map, so no need to hurry.
Meaning of Friendship Gertrude's House - Gertrude wants you to find the crystal to impress your friendship with her. Go to Spiral Cave and defeat the Nar to get the crystal. * Update: Nar can be fought at Lightsfall for a Crystal.
Bruno’s Beast Windhym Southshire – Your friend, Bruno informs you that there’s a beast blocking your path and needs your help to capture him. Go to Southshire Bridge and capture him.
Defeat Leonard Madbeetch Rapids – Leonard thinks you’re not really strong. Prove him how wrong he is.
Find Bruno Titans Staircase – Lumbard informs you that your friend has taken the raft down the dangerous river and worries about his safety. Find your friend at Otto’s House at Pueblonia by taking the Taxi Cat. (Taxi Cat can be located by clicking the Travel button on top left corner.)
Pueblonia
Save Bruno Otto’s House – Your friend is unconscious and the leader of the Otto tribe need you to find an Electrotter to revive him. Go to Electrotter Sound to find it. (Whether you catch it or defeat it, the story still continues.)
Find Sandman Completing Save Bruno – The leader of the Otto tribe needs your help to find Sandman and tell him to stop attacking him. Sandman can be found at Fingerland Point.
Defeat Sandman Fingerland Point – Looks like Sandman refuses to listen to you. Guess you have to make him listen to you by fighting. Defeat Sandman.
Family Jewels Completing Defeat Sandman – Sandman explains his reason for attacking and needs your help to bring back his family jewels since he can’t survive in the desert. Fight the Mogas and collect 3 jewels between Portal o’ Ruins and Sitnalta Field.
Souper Saver Completing Family Jewels – Sandman thanks you for bringing the family jewels back and wants to serve you a meal as an reward. However, he needs a special pot in order to make a grand meal. Defeat the Mogas between Sinatla Plaza and Biting Coast.
Capture Chamepo Surf City – Rip the Surfer needs your help to find him a Moga as his surfboard. But to do that, you need a Chamepo since the Moga loves to eat Chamepo. Find Chamepo and capture it at Talonsweep Point.
Capture Hammerdog Completing Capture Chamepo – Now that you have the bait, it’s time to lure in the Moga. Find Hammerdog and capture it at Biting Coast.
The Princess and the Purse Rouges Rendezvous – A “princess” needs your assistance to bring back her purse. Defeat a Moga at Sandsink.
Find the Thief Completing Princess and the Purse – You’ve discovered that your wallet is stolen. It looks like that Princess is not really a princess. Go back to Rouges Rendezvous and confront her by fighting.
Lost Treasure Completing Find the Thief – The thief informs you that she’s looking for the treasure and needs your help to find it. Defeat the Mogas between Rogues Rendezvous and Sandtown and collect 1 treasure chest. (Rune Dunes is the easiest to obtain the treasures.)
Save the Kitty Sandtown – A girl needs your help to rescue her kitty. Go to Lobster Tornado and defeat a Moga.
The First Guard Pueblonia City Gates – Nova dislikes how the Prince behaves and wants you to teach the Prince a lesson by first defeating his guards. Go to Parapets Dawn to defeat the first guard.
The Second Guard Completing First Guard – The first Guard lets you pass and warns you about the second guard. Defeat the second guard at Prince’s Patch.
Defeat the Sultan Completing Second Guard – The second Guard lets you pass and warns you about unable to defeat the Prince. Go to the Royal Battledome and defeat the Prince.
Impress the Tough Guys Dungeness Dock – The Retired Soldiers think you’re not strong. Prove them wrong by defeating them.
Crab Dinner Completing Impress the Tough Guys – The Retired Soldiers need you to collect 5 crablegs for dinner. Defeat the Crabones and collect 5 crablegs at Dungeness Dock.
Dungeness Showdown Completing Crab Dinner – The Retired Soldiers are impressed with your skill and think that having Azurel on your team will improve. Capture Azurel at Dungeness Dock. (You don’t need to worry about accidentally killing it since the quest involves you catching it.)
Brain Candy Swirly Dump – The Cortex Scientists are hungry and needs you to bring them food since they can’t leave the area (due to their work) and will give you information about the earthquakes. Defeat the Mogas between Pueblonia City Gates and Super Bazaar and collect 5 candy bars. Some Mogas will not give you candies. (Radiojack seems to give the candy the most.)
Bog Cleanup Marshamarsha Marsh – Pierce need your assistance to capture a Moga from terrorizing the citizens. He thinks having the Moga will make a great addition to your team. Go to Rankwallow and capture Shen. (You don’t need to worry about accidentally kill since the quest involves you capturing it.)
Talk to Pierce Completing Bog Cleanup – Pierce is impressed of your work and has a favor to ask you. However, he has other jobs to do so he needs you to meet him up at a certain place. Go to Lazuli Grove to talk to him.

[Beginner's Guide on How to]
The location of the game: Gaiaonline: MoGaia Viximo Facebook: Facebook Version
As you start of you'll have the option to pick one out of 36 Moga. There are 3 optional Moga according to the 12 Zodiac Sign. Here you choose your Moga, whichever you want. After that you'll start with Nova guiding you on the basics: how to attack and capture Mogas, which is the essence of the game. Then you'll capture your first Moga, Huey. The next quest by Nova obligates you to capture a Beefee making you have a complete team of three Mogas all level 1.
General Tips: 1. Item Types: There are three item types - Whistles, Blue Coffee and Star Seeds.
Whistles are fruits that grants you a Bonus Attack. Blue Coffee is a Full Restore item. If your Moga is dead, low on health or low on AP (Ability Points), they'll restore those completely. Star Seeds are the devices that allows you to capture a Moga.
2. Moga Abilities: A Moga has 4 abilities- Normal Attack, Zodiac Attack, Special Ability, Bonus Attack.
Normal Attacks have 15 AP, in other words 15 uses before it runs outs. It doesn't have any special appliers. Zodiac Attacks have 5 AP. It's your Zodiac sign versus the other. Depending on which sign you are and the opponent is, you can have anything from: 3x Super Effective, 2x Effective, More Effective, - 2x Not Effective Special Abilities have 5 AP. And can range from Health Regain, Weakening opponent, Slowing them down to allow you a higher chance to escape, higher chances to get turns, or making them take damage over time. Bonus Attacks only require a Whistle. Bonus Attacks can stack in a turn, meaning you can keep using them in a turn.
3. Zodiac
There are 12 Zodiacs, 3 for every element. Fire, Water, Earth or Wind.
4. Rarity:
When you throw a Star Seed, you'll see a percentile telling you your chances of capturing that Moga. These are the types: Beginner (90%-100%), Common(60%-85%), Rare (35%-50%), Very Rare, Epic (Only one I saw was 4% and that was a Spike).
5. Home
Once you click it, it instantly transport you there. You can do a few things here: See all your captured Mogas. Make them take a Rest (Time for a complete rest increases depending on the level). Feeding them a Blue Coffee (They can be used during battles). Switch your Mogas using your DEX. Grabbing Whistles and WATERING your Whistle Tree. You can also go to your friend's home and grab Whistles.
